    I’ve just upgraded to v3.0.3

    In the update, the API key and sources were preserved & I have some tweaking of the CSS to do to suite my site, so most things are OK.

    I use 3 google calendars as sources and use 2 of them with a grid & list version for the site. 4 work perfectly, but one will not.

    In the ‘All Calendars’ list this problem calendar shows the Events Source & Calendar Type as ‘—’, but when I go to edit the settings, the correct choices are there. I make a couple of options choices and save, but the ‘All Calendars’ page still shows ‘—’ for the source and type.

    I’ve tried deleting the calendar & creating a new one – same outcome. The same calendar source is working perfectly as a grid view – I just need the same calendar source as a list. Clearing the cache does nothing.

    The other calendar I use as a grid & list both work perfectly.
